A common reported fault involves the screws in the front window glazing bar . Over time, these can work loose, allowing moisture to seep behind the seal.
Some older models may experience "spongy" floors. This occurs when the layers of the sandwich floor begin to separate, often requiring a resin injection repair. 2. Interior Fit & Finish
